 Two tournaments of Speedway European Championships, two wins of Nicki Pedersen. The first one convincing, the second quite lucky but also deserved. Nicki Pedersen is seeking the European Champion title, the title which he lost last season at the very last moment.

 In Gustrow generally he ruled on a black track. In Togliatti he had good and bad moments. Two wins, including the most important – in the final he won for the second time because the heats were restarted. At this moment it seems that Nicki Pedersen wants to fight successfully for the European Champion title.

After two first tournaments “Power” is two points ahead Emil Sajfutdinow. Russian is still better and better and he will definitely also want to have gold medal on his neck. It is worth to remember that he wasn’t able to fight for the title because of the injury. Similarly to Nicki Pedersen, Russian has something to prove his fans and himself and that’s why he will want to catch the Dane.

The third round of SEC in Holsted at Moldow Arena can be essential , Nicki Pedersen would like to enlarge his advantage. He has really big chance to do that because Holsted is his home track and what is more is he knows every centimeter of the track which lead to the victory.

Another Dane, Peter Kildemand also can’t be forgotten because he is now on the third place in genral classification and he also would like to score many points in Holsted. This rider proves again that 2014 is the best season in his career so far. Many candidates and only one gold medal. Who will be closer? We’ll already find out on the 9th of August in Holsted.
